The internet shattered this model. The rise of digital platforms initiated a democratization of content creation that has fundamentally altered the definition of "popular media." Today, a teenager in a bedroom with a ring light and a smartphone can command an audience larger than a cable news network.
Furthermore, popular media is more global than ever. The success of South Korea’s Squid Game or Spain’s Money Heist proves that language barriers are dissolving in the face of high-quality, relatable entertainment content. 5. The Future: Immersion and Interactivity
